-
公开(公告)号:US08918452B2
公开(公告)日:2014-12-23
申请号:US13247700
申请日:2011-09-28
申请人: Henrik Frystyk Nielsen , Glenn Block , Randall Tombaugh , Ronald A. Cain , HongMei Ge , Alexander Corradini
发明人: Henrik Frystyk Nielsen , Glenn Block , Randall Tombaugh , Ronald A. Cain , HongMei Ge , Alexander Corradini
摘要: Embodiments allow developers to use HTTP message abstractions inline within their Web API methods to directly access and manipulate HTTP request and response messages. A hosting layer is provided for in-process, in-memory and network-based services. Message handlers and operational handlers may be combined to create a message channel for asynchronous manipulations of the HTTP requests and response. A formatter may be used on the server or client for consuming HTTP and providing desired media types.
摘要翻译: 实施例允许开发人员在其Web API方法内部使用HTTP消息抽象来直接访问和操纵HTTP请求和响应消息。 为进程内,内存和基于网络的服务提供托管层。 消息处理程序和操作处理程序可以组合以创建用于异步操纵HTTP请求和响应的消息通道。 可以在服务器或客户端上使用格式化程序来消费HTTP并提供所需的媒体类型。
-
公开(公告)号:US09344335B2
公开(公告)日:2016-05-17
申请号:US13229499
申请日:2011-09-09
申请人: Suhail Khalid , Alexander Corradini , Michael A. Ziller , Ravi T. Rao , David G. Thaler , Andrew J. Ritz
发明人: Suhail Khalid , Alexander Corradini , Michael A. Ziller , Ravi T. Rao , David G. Thaler , Andrew J. Ritz
IPC分类号: G06F15/16 , H04L12/24 , H04L12/26 , H04L12/14 , H04L29/08 , H04N21/237 , H04N21/238 , H04N21/2743 , H04N21/442 , H04N21/61 , G06Q10/06
CPC分类号: H04L43/0876 , G06Q10/06 , H04L12/1421 , H04L41/0893 , H04L41/0896 , H04L43/16 , H04L63/20 , H04L67/02 , H04L67/34 , H04L69/321 , H04N21/237 , H04N21/23805 , H04N21/2743 , H04N21/44204 , H04N21/44209 , H04N21/6181
摘要: Network communication and cost awareness techniques are described. In one or more implementations, functionality is exposed through one or more application programming interfaces (APIs) that is accessible to a plurality of applications of the computing device to perform network communication. Data is returned to one or more of the plurality of applications regarding a cost network used to perform the network communication.
摘要翻译: 描述了网络通信和成本意识技术。 在一个或多个实现中,通过可由计算设备的多个应用访问的一个或多个应用程序编程接口(API)来公开功能以执行网络通信。 数据被返回到关于用于执行网络通信的成本网络的多个应用中的一个或多个。
-
公开(公告)号:US20130080505A1
公开(公告)日:2013-03-28
申请号:US13247700
申请日:2011-09-28
申请人: Henrik Frystyk Nielsen , Glenn Block , Randall Tombaugh , Ronald A. Cain , HongMei Ge , Alexander Corradini
发明人: Henrik Frystyk Nielsen , Glenn Block , Randall Tombaugh , Ronald A. Cain , HongMei Ge , Alexander Corradini
摘要: Embodiments allow developers to use HTTP message abstractions inline within their Web API methods to directly access and manipulate HTTP request and response messages. A hosting layer is provided for in-process, in-memory and network-based services. Message handlers and operational handlers may be combined to create a message channel for asynchronous manipulations of the HTTP requests and response. A formatter may be used on the server or client for consuming HTTP and providing desired media types.
摘要翻译: 实施例允许开发人员在其Web API方法内部使用HTTP消息抽象来直接访问和操纵HTTP请求和响应消息。 为进程内,内存和基于网络的服务提供托管层。 消息处理程序和操作处理程序可以组合以创建用于异步操纵HTTP请求和响应的消息通道。 可以在服务器或客户端上使用格式化程序来消费HTTP并提供所需的媒体类型。
-
公开(公告)号:US20130067061A1
公开(公告)日:2013-03-14
申请号:US13229499
申请日:2011-09-09
申请人: Suhail Khalid , Alexander Corradini , Michael A. Ziller , Ravi T. Rao , David G. Thaler , Andrew J. Ritz
发明人: Suhail Khalid , Alexander Corradini , Michael A. Ziller , Ravi T. Rao , David G. Thaler , Andrew J. Ritz
IPC分类号: G06F15/173
CPC分类号: H04L43/0876 , G06Q10/06 , H04L12/1421 , H04L41/0893 , H04L41/0896 , H04L43/16 , H04L63/20 , H04L67/02 , H04L67/34 , H04L69/321 , H04N21/237 , H04N21/23805 , H04N21/2743 , H04N21/44204 , H04N21/44209 , H04N21/6181
摘要: Network communication and cost awareness techniques are described. In one or more implementations, functionality is exposed through one or more application programming interfaces (APIs) that is accessible to a plurality of applications of the computing device to perform network communication. Data is returned to one or more of the plurality of applications regarding a cost network used to perform the network communication.
摘要翻译: 描述了网络通信和成本意识技术。 在一个或多个实现中,通过可由计算设备的多个应用访问的一个或多个应用程序编程接口(API)来公开功能以执行网络通信。 数据被返回到关于用于执行网络通信的成本网络的多个应用中的一个或多个。
-
-
-